You’ve to install that software on your computer. In this article, I’m writing about a free online service available at Reshade that can enlarge or resize your pictures without losing quality. However, Reshade offers a limited 2x zoom to enlarge the picture for a free online service and moreover, it has a limit on the number of pictures that you can resize free in a day. It also has paid service that offers much higher enlargement zoom factor (unlimited zoom factor) with a maximum resolution of 6000×3750 pixel size.
With the free online service to enlarge a picture, the maximum supported resolution is 1920×1200 pixel with the zoom factor limited to 2x. For using the free service, visit Reshade and upload your image from your computer or provide a web link if that image is already available online at some web address. Thereafter, on the next screen, select the new image size from the drop-down list box and also select other options (see figure below) and then click on “resize it” button:

Within a few seconds, your image will be resized and you can download and save it. For example, see the following original image of 800×600 pixel size (click on the image to view it in its full size):
And, after enlarging it by a zoom factor of 2x (maximum permitted zoom factor for free service), the resized image of 1600×1200 pixel size is shown below (click on the image to view it in its full size):
For the free online service, Reshade allows you to upload up to 3 images per day; these images will be deleted after a short-while unless you create an account (even free account is available); moreover, you’ll not be able to crop images.
Reshade supports JPG, BMP, GIF, PNG image types (single frames and non-transparent). Maximum supported file size is 10MB. Maximum supported image size is 4000×4000 pixels while the minimum supported image size is 50×50 pixels.
